lkml.org 
[lkml]   [2011]   [May]   [16]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
Subject[PATCH V5 6/6 net-next] example: enable zero-copy support in ixgbe
From
Date
Device can enable zero-copy flag when HIGHDMA is supported.

Signed-off-by: Shirley Ma <xma@us.ibm.com>
---

drivers/net/ixgbe/ixgbe_main.c | 4 ++++
1 files changed, 4 insertions(+), 0 deletions(-)

diff --git a/drivers/net/ixgbe/ixgbe_main.c b/drivers/net/ixgbe/ixgbe_main.c
index 2dce3d0..7e9e881 100644
--- a/drivers/net/ixgbe/ixgbe_main.c
+++ b/drivers/net/ixgbe/ixgbe_main.c
@@ -7553,6 +7553,10 @@ static int __devinit ixgbe_probe(struct pci_dev *pdev,
netdev->vlan_features |= NETIF_F_HIGHDMA;
}

+ /* enable zero-copy when device supports HIGHDMA */
+ if (netdev->features & NETIF_F_HIGHDMA)
+ netdev->features |= NETIF_F_ZEROCOPY;
+
if (adapter->flags2 & IXGBE_FLAG2_RSC_ENABLED)
netdev->features |= NETIF_F_LRO;




\
 
 \ /
  Last update: 2011-05-16 21:45    [W:0.027 / U:0.224 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site